Kim Zydel, CPA

Kim Zydel is a partner at DZH Phillips LLP. Her years of professional experience provide a full range of tax planning and compliance services to corporations, partnerships, individuals, trusts and estates, and clients in the nonprofit sector.

Much of Kim's experience has been in services to real estate partnerships, as well as small and family-owned businesses. These services typically involve all areas of personal and business tax planning and compliance, including issues relating to trusts, estates, and international operations.

Kim has assisted many of our clients in adopting more advantageous tax positions, including areas such as change in accounting method, business structure, like-kind exchanges, and use of installment sales reporting.

Kim began her career with Deloitte, Haskins & Sells (now Deloitte & Touche).  She later became a tax partner with the San Francisco accounting practice of Wilson, McCall & Daoro and subseqently, a partner with Daoro Zydel & Holland. When DZH merged with Smith, Lange & Phillips, Kim continued her role as a tax partner with the newly formed firm.  

Education

Kim received her Bachelor of Science degree in accounting from California State University at Long Beach and her Master of Science degree in taxation from Golden Gate University. Kim has pursued courses in certified financial planning at U.C. Berkeley.

Associations

Kim is a member of the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ants and the California Society of Certified Public Accountants. She has served on the tax review team for CPAmerica, International.

Kim actively participates in industry seminars and teaches tax seminars for our professional staff as well as for our clients.
